Modelo de Visão par Software
SICCD - SISTEMA DE CONTROLE DE CDs DE MÚSICA
01.Introdução
Esse tutorial visa mostrar o desenvolvimento de um sistema simplificado para controle de CDs de músicas, denominado de SICCD.
Considere que você foi contratado para desenvolver esse sistema para um amigo que possui uma biblioteca de CDs. Esse amigo, inicialmente explicou que ele deseja controlar o cadastro de CDs de músicas, sendo que cada CD possui um título, uma identificação, nome do artista ou da banda e que deve ser caracterizado pelo estilo de música (MPB, rock, instrumental e outros estilos).
02.Detalhamentos
02.01.Introdução
Diversos autores destacam uma relação de documentos necessários para gerenciar as diversas etapas do desenvolvimento de um software. Para esse pequeno aplicativo iremos considerar os seguintes documentos:
Documento de Visão, DRAS (Documento de Requisitos e Analise de Sistemas) e DOPS(Documento do Projeto do Sistema). É interessante utilizar documentos como arquitetura do sistema, glossário do sistema, manual do usuário e manual do sistema.
De posse das informações iniciais sobre o sistema, e dos detalhes sobre os prováveis usuários (stakeholders) que auxiliarão no desenvolvimento do software, realizou-se algumas reuniões com os “usuários” e, através de técnicas de levantamento de requisitos, você organizou e ajustou os requisitos do sistema. Finalmente, você apresentou o documento de visão, destacado em anexo, que foi aprovado pelo patrocinador do projeto.
Posteriormente, você preparou um documento sobre alguns detalhes funcionais da aplicação, incluindo os protótipos para estabelecer uma melhor compreensão do funcionamento e da aparência do produto final. Pois, a prototipagem é um processo interativo que faz parte da etapa de análise. O uso de protótipos na construção de sistemas vem tendo aceitação cada vez maior, pois ajuda a prevenir eventuais falhas de especificação e de codificação. Assim, você criou o DRAS – Documento